On the Webmaster Tools Home page, click the site you want. On the Dashboard, under Health, click Fetch as Google. In the text box, type the path to the page you want to check. In the dropdown list, select Web. (You can select another type of page, but currently we only accept submissions for our Web Search index.) Click Fetch. Google will fetch the URL you requested. It may take up to 10 or 15 minutes for Fetch status to be updated. Once you see a Fetch status of "Successful", click Submit to Index, and then click one of the following: To submit the individual URL to Google's index, select URL and click Submit. You can submit up to 500 URLs a week in this way. To submit the URL and all pages linked from it, click URL and all linked pages. You can submit up to 10 of these requests a month.
